Which verison on NES are you using ?? 3.5+ supports servlets by itself -
though they *recommend* use of servlet engines.
Which servlet are you trying to run ?? Simple SnoopServlet which comes with
NES should work without any problem if you have properly enabled JAVA in the
NES installation ..
